Background technology
Present iron ore dressing, usually allows iron ore husky from eminence whereabouts, and magnetic coil is pacified in centre position, uses magnetic
The falling direction of iron ore is sexually revised, ore dressing pond is fallen into, impregnable direct whereabouts is useless sand, completes ore dressing, that is, give
Magnetic iron ore one speed of sand, one external force containing iron ore is given in the vertical direction of sand drift again, allows iron content and nonferrous ore in sand form to divide
Open, complete ore dressing;But the speed of ore in sand form is relevant with the height for falling, and height is can not be infinitely increased, also just defines ore in sand form
Speed.
By the way that after superelevation magnetic concentration, the waste residue in ore deposit sand still has, and influences ore in sand form grade.To find out its cause, being to elect
Ore in sand form in, have non-required composition particle and need ore grain adhesion, as far as possible this partial particulate remove, just can improve
Ore in sand form grade.
After a kind of parabola hits ore in sand form formula magnetite device ore dressing, some non-required particles are due to the original of speed
Cause, can fall into ore dressing pond by mistake, cause the grade of ore dressing and reduce.

Operation principle of the invention is as follows:The speed of magnetic iron ore sand drift is bigger, and the inertia of ore in sand form is bigger, in superelevation magnetic
In, useful ore in sand form can change coasting trajectory, be moved energetically towards magnetic direction, and so useful ore in sand form and useless ore in sand form are separate
Power is bigger, it is easier to which useful ore in sand form is elected;Revolving charging gear evenly falls ore in sand form on parabola wheel,
In the rotary course of the parabola wheel under motor drive, after parabola is ore in sand form collision, the impact fallen, change ore in sand form in water
Square to motion, ore in sand form also passes through superelevation magnetic magnetic field with new speed, completes ore dressing;The rotation of the decrease speed and parabola wheel of ore in sand form
After rotary speed matching, the requirement of superelevation magnetic concentration and beneficiating efficiency is reached;Have on superelevation magnetoelectricity magnetic coil and magnetic iron ore is pulled away from magnetic
Device, magnetic iron ore sand ribbon on superelevation magnetoelectricity magnetic coil will be inhaled and walked, until taking away magnetic field, magnetic iron ore sand will freely under
Fall ore dressing pond;The initial velocity of ore in sand form, depending on the velocity of rotation of parabola wheel;Correction for direction device, corrects the fortune of ore in sand form
Dynamic direction;Before super-high magnetic field ore dressing terminates, then bombarded by ultrasonic wave is husky to magnetic iron ore, ingredient granules the need in ore in sand form with
The particle adhesion of non-required composition is tried one's best and is interrupted, and beneficial in super-high magnetic field, the particle of non-required composition is tried one's best removing, is improved
Ore in sand form grade;The ore deposit elected, forms magnetic iron ore sand drift, again by super-high magnetic field magnetite device, not by bakie
Particle screen selecting is needed out, to improve ore in sand form grade again.
